    The brewer recommends that draught Guinness should be served at 6-7 °C (42.8 °F), [94] while Extra Cold Guinness should be served at 3.5 °C (38.6 °F). [95] Before the 21st century, it was popular to serve Guinness at cellar temperature (about 13 °C) and some drinkers preferred it at room temperature (about 20 °C).
